Transaction 6a843568eb60bb081fd65894040d7c6c6a75a679872e14e961ee6aa7c0d12d93
2 Input
2 Outputs
- 6a843568eb60bb081fd65894040d7c6c6a75a679872e14e961ee6aa7c0d12d93:0
- 6a843568eb60bb081fd65894040d7c6c6a75a679872e14e961ee6aa7c0d12d93:1
value 1284307
address 3FXDe43NazaXiyNQeHG1aMTp3GwZoC5CG7
value 973303
address 17Ho31pTa1s3SHxUCFx4oygTZsKTEGNsj1